Tender brussels sprouts covered with a creamy cheesy parmesan heavy cream sauce. Topped with shredded mozzarella cheese and crispy bacon bits. This is the perfect casserole to make as a side dish for any dinner, or as an Easter side dish. This side dish is a delicious holiday casserole that is great to have anytime of the year, but I especially enjoy it for Easter dinner. Two types of cheeses are used for this casserole, grated parmesan cheese is used in the sauce. Then it is topped off with shredded mozzarella cheese.

Before the brussels sprouts are baked, they are boiled until they are tender. To make the creamy heavy cream parmesan sauce, butter is melted in a medium saucepan. Cook minced garlic in the butter until the garlic is fragrant. Add flour and cook it for a minute to brown, this is what will create the roux that will help thicken the sauce. Pour in heavy cream, grated parmesan cheese, salt and pepper. Continue to cook the sauce, while whisking constantly until the sauce has thickened. Mix the sauce with the cooked brussels sprouts. Top with shredded mozzarella cheese and bacon bits, or you could also use cooked and crumbled bacon instead. Bake until the cheese has melted and the brussels sprouts are fork tender.

Cheesy Bacon Brussels Sprouts Casserole

freshlyhomecooked

Ingredients
  

  • 2 pounds fresh brussels sprouts
  • 2 tablespoons butter
  • 2 tablespoons all-purpose flour
  • 2 cloves garlic, minced
  • 1 1/2 cups heavy cream
  • 1/2 cup grated parmesan cheese
  • 1/2 teaspoon salt
  • 1/4 teaspoon ground black pepper
  • 1/2 cup shredded mozzarella cheese
  • 1/2 cup bacon bits, or 3 slices cooked and crumbled bacon

Instructions
 

  • Preheat oven to 350 F. Cut the ends off of the brussels sprouts and place them into a large saucepan. Cover with water and bring to a boil over medium heat. Let cook for about 5-10 minutes, until tender.
  • Drain and place brussels sprouts into a round baking dish. In a medium saucepan over medium heat, melt butter. Cook minced garlic until fragrant. Add in flour and cook for a minute to brown.
  • Add in heavy cream, grated parmesan cheese, salt and pepper. Let cook while whisking constantly, until the sauce has thickened.
  • Mix sauce with brussels sprouts in the baking dish. Top with shredded mozzarella cheese and sprinkle with bacon bits. Bake for 40-50 minutes.
